As a proper noun ObamaCare
is any of various healthcare plans seen as associated with Barack Obama before or during his tenure as U.S. President; especially, the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act: a healthcare reform plan that was passed in 2010 and signed into law by him.As a noun Obamacrat is
a democratic supporter of Barrack Obamaobamacare
